某二叉树中度为2的结点有18个,则该二叉树中有【 】个叶子结点

作者&投稿:丁强 (若有异议请与网页底部的电邮联系)
某二叉树中度为2的结点有18个,则该二叉树中有【 】个叶子结点~

19
性质1:二叉树的终端结点(叶子结点)数等于双分支结点数加1。
假设二叉树中终端结点数为n0,单分支结点数为n1,双分支结点数为n2,二叉树中总结点数为n,因为二叉树中所有结点度数均小于或等于2,所以有:n=n0+n1+n2;另一方面,二叉树中所有结点的分支数(即度数)应等于单分支结点数加上两倍的双分支结点数,即n1+2×n2。由树的性质1,有:n=n1+2×n2+1。根据以上两个式子,我们可以得出下面这个等式成立:n0+n1+n2=
n1+2×n2+1,所以n0=n2+1。

19个叶子节点,记住:在二叉树中,度为1的节点(叶子节点)总是比度为2的节点多一个.

某二叉树中度为2的结点有18个,则该二叉树中有19个叶子结点,具体分析如下:

二叉树是n个有限元素的集合,该集合或者为空、或者由一个称为根的元素及两个不相交的、被分别称为左子树和右子树的二叉树组成,是有序树。当集合为空时,称该二叉树为空二叉树。在二叉树中,一个元素也称作一个结点;

叶子结点:也称为终端结点,没有子树的结点或者度为零的结点;

根据二叉树的一个性质:若在任意一棵二叉树中,有n个叶子节点,有n₂个度为2的节点,则必有n₀=n₂+1,可以得到,叶子节点的数目等于度为2的节点的数目加1;

所以,某二叉树中度为2的结点有18个,则该二叉树中有18+1=19个叶子结点。

扩展资料:

特殊的二叉树:

1、满二叉树:如果一棵二叉树只有度为0的结点和度为2的结点,并且度为0的结点在同一层上,则这棵二叉树为满二叉树;

2、完全二叉树:深度为k,有n个结点的二叉树当且仅当其每一个结点都与深度为k,有n个结点的满二叉树中编号从1到n的结点一一对应时,称为完全二叉树;

完全二叉树的特点是叶子结点只可能出现在层序最大的两层上,并且某个结点的左分支下子孙的最大层序与右分支下子孙的最大层序相等或大1。

参考资料来源:百度百科-二叉树



19 ,二叉树具有如下性质:在任意一棵二叉树中,度为0的结点(即叶子结点)总是比度为2的结点多一个。根据题意,度为2的结点为18个,那么,叶子结点就应当是19个。因此,本题的正确答案为选项B。

19

性质1:二叉树的终端结点(叶子结点)数等于双分支结点数加1。

假设二叉树中终端结点数为n0,单分支结点数为n1,双分支结点数为n2,二叉树中总结点数为n,因为二叉树中所有结点度数均小于或等于2,所以有:n=n0+n1+n2;另一方面,二叉树中所有结点的分支数(即度数)应等于单分支结点数加上两倍的双分支结点数,即n1+2×n2。由树的性质1,有:n=n1+2×n2+1。根据以上两个式子,我们可以得出下面这个等式成立:n0+n1+n2= n1+2×n2+1,所以n0=n2+1。

19个
公式是 叶子结点数=度为2的结点数+1


数据结构: 假定在一棵二叉树中,度为2的结点数为15个,度为1的结点数为3...
B。对于任何一颗二叉树T,如果其终端结点数为n0,度为2的结点数为n2,则,n0=n2+1,叶子结点(终端结点)no=15+1=16。或:每个分枝下面都有一个结点,所以总结点数N=2*15+1*32+0*叶子数+1(根节点)=63 二叉树中除了双分支结点,单分支结点就是叶子结点 所以叶子数=63-15-32=16 ...

在深度为7的满二叉树中,度为2的结点个数为多少?
所以深度为7的满二叉树度为2的结点数为2^6-1 = 63。特殊类型 1、满二叉树:如果一棵二叉树只有度为0的节点和度为2的节点,并且度为0的节点在同一层上,则这棵二叉树为满二叉树。2、完全二叉树:深度为k,有n个节点的二叉树当且仅当其每一个节点都与深度为k的满二叉树中编号从1到n的节点...

某二叉树中度为2的结点有18个,则该二叉树中有【 】个叶子结点
某二叉树中度为2的结点有18个,则该二叉树中有19个叶子结点,具体分析如下:二叉树是n个有限元素的集合,该集合或者为空、或者由一个称为根的元素及两个不相交的、被分别称为左子树和右子树的二叉树组成,是有序树。当集合为空时,称该二叉树为空二叉树。在二叉树中,一个元素也称作一个结点;...

一棵二叉树的度为2,叶子节点的数量是多少?
计算公式:n0=n2+1,n0是叶子节点的个数,n2是度为2的结点的个数。在数据结构中,树是一种非线性的数据结构,它由节点和边组成,每个节点可以有零个或多个子节点。树的叶子节点是指没有子节点的节点,也可以称作终端节点或者叶节点。计算叶子节点的个数通常有两种方法:递归法:从根节点开始遍历整...

...要么是2。这棵二叉树中度为2的结点有( )个。
33个,二叉树性质3 在任意-棵二叉树中,若终端结点的个数为n0,度为2的结点数为n2,则no=n2+1。由n0=n2+1, n0+n2=67,得 n2 = 33 参考资料:http:\/\/blog.csdn.net\/dragonfly0939\/archive\/2008\/10\/29\/3170874.aspx

某二叉树中有n个度为2的结点,则该二叉树中的叶子结点为
为n+1。解题过程:一、对任何一棵二叉树T,如果其终端节点数为n0,度为2的节点数为n2,则n0=n2+1.二、设n1为二叉树T中度为1的结点数 三、因为二叉树中所有结点的度军小于或等于2,所以其结点总数为 n=n0+n1+n2 (1)再看二叉树中的分支数.除了根结点外,其余结点都有一个分支进入,设B为...

二叉树是怎么算叶子结点数和度为1的结点数的
1,n= n0+n1+n2(其中n为完全二叉树的结点总数);又因为一个度为2的结点会有2个子结点,一个度为1的结点会有1个子结点,除根结点外其他结点都有父结点。2,n= 1+n1+2*n2;由①、②两式把n2消去得:n= 2*n0+n1-1,由于完全二叉树中度为1的结点数只有两种可能0或1,由此得到n0=n\/2...

某二叉树中有n个叶子节点,则该二叉树中度为2的结点数为?
你好:这个一般都是填空题,答案:n+1 对任何一棵二叉树T,如果其终端节点数为n0,度为2的节点数为n2,则n0=n2+1.设n1为二叉树T中度为1的结点数.因为二叉树中所有结点的度军小于或等于2,所以其结点总数为 n=n0+n1+n2 (1)再看二叉树中的分支数.除了根结点外,其余结点都有一个分支进入,...

为什么二叉树度为0的结点总比度为2的结点多1个,证明下!
对于任意一棵二叉树BT,如果度为0的结点个数为n0,度为2的结点个数为n2,则n0=n2+1。证明:假设度为1的结点个数为n1,结点总数为n,B为二叉树中的分支数。因为在二叉树中,所有结点的度均小于或等于2,所以结点总数为:n=n0+n1+n2 (1)再查看一下分支数。在二叉树中,除根结点之外,每个...

若一棵二叉树有11个叶子结点,则该二叉树中度为2的结点个数是?
节点个数是10。1、总结点数n = n0+ n1 + n2,总结点数等于叶子结点数+度为1的结点数+ 度为2的结点数。另外,考虑一下二叉树中的线,度为1的结点出去的线为1,度为2的结点线出去的为2。每个结点除根结点外都有一条线进入,所以n-1 = 2n2 + n1。2、在计算机科学中,二叉树是每个节点最...

锦屏县15099638327: 某二叉树中度为2的结点有18个,则该二叉树中有 多少个叶子结点. -
主父查托尼:[答案] ∵叶子结点数=度为2的结点数+1 度为2的结点有18个 ∴叶子结点数=18+1=19

锦屏县15099638327: 某二叉树中度为2的结点有18个,则该二叉树中有【 】个叶子结点某二叉树中度为2的结点有18个,则该二叉树中有【 】个叶子结点怎么做这个题?公式是什么 -
主父查托尼:[答案] 总顶点数=总度数+1.设度为1的有x,叶子节点y. 18+x+y=2*18+1*x+1. y=19

锦屏县15099638327: 某二叉树中度为2的结点有18个,则该二叉树中有 - - - 个叶子结点 -
主父查托尼: 度为2的结点是什么意思...如果理解没错的话应该有3个叶结点.

锦屏县15099638327: 某二叉树中 度为2的结点有18个 则该二叉树有?个叶子结点 能给个具体回答吗?! -
主父查托尼: 19个叶子节点,记住:在二叉树中,度为1的节点(叶子节点)总是比度为2的节点多一个.

锦屏县15099638327: 题目:某二叉树中度为2的结点有18个,则该二叉树中有几个叶子结点?此题中的 度为2 是什么意思? -
主父查托尼: 19 首先,结点的度是指树中每个结点具有的子树个数或者说是后继结点数. 题中的度为2是说具有的2个子树的结点; 二叉树有个性质:二叉树上叶子结点数等于度为2的结点数加1.

锦屏县15099638327: 二叉树度为2的结点有18,则此树最少多少个结点 -
主父查托尼: 叶子节点个数为度为2节点加1即19 一个二叉树中只有叶子节点,度为1的节点和度为2的节点 节点最少只有度为1的节点个数为0(例如哈夫曼树) 最少节点为37

锦屏县15099638327: 二叉树中度为2的结点有18个,则此二叉树中有 -- 个叶子结点 -
主父查托尼: 二叉树中,叶子结点个数比度为2的结点个数多1个.所以应为19个.

锦屏县15099638327: 为什么度为2的树结点有18,则树的借点有19? -
主父查托尼:[答案] 因为度为0的树比度为2的树结点多一!

锦屏县15099638327: C语言的题
主父查托尼: 二 提问人的追问 2011-03-25 18:39 拜托你再给我讲道题吧,谢谢.某二叉树中度为2的结点有18个,则该二叉树中有多少个叶子结点.叉树共有多少个结点=度为1的+度为2的+度为0的.度为0的=度为2的+1.你在算下.叶子结点就是度为0的结点.就是19个啊.

本站内容来自于网友发表,不代表本站立场,仅表示其个人看法,不对其真实性、正确性、有效性作任何的担保
相关事宜请发邮件给我们
© 星空见康网